Global Governance, Sustainable Development and Smart Cities

The topic basically deals with the issues converging global governance, Sustainable Development and the emerging concept of smart cities in South Asia. It covers the structural, institutional, and normative challenges and issues of the current global order precisely South Asia. Likewise, the topic also touches upon the concept of sustainability extending extensively in the areas such as health, education, freedom, equality, climate change, clean energy and green economy providing a wealth of insights to its readers.
